当前位置:首页 > jquery

jquery获取元素id

2026-04-08 09:53:36jquery

jQuery获取元素ID的方法

使用jQuery获取元素的ID可以通过多种方式实现,以下是几种常见的方法:

通过DOM元素属性获取ID

当已经获取到jQuery对象时,可以通过attr()方法或直接访问DOM元素的id属性:

var id = $('#element').attr('id');
// 或
var id = $('#element')[0].id;

通过事件触发获取当前元素ID

jquery获取元素id

在事件处理函数中,可以通过this关键字获取当前触发事件的元素ID:

$('.some-class').click(function() {
    var id = $(this).attr('id');
    // 或
    var id = this.id;
});

注意事项

jquery获取元素id

使用jQuery获取ID时需要注意:

  • 确保元素在DOM加载完成后才执行查询
  • 如果元素不存在,返回的结果会是undefined
  • 对于多个匹配元素,只会返回第一个元素的ID

性能优化建议

对于只需要获取ID而不需要其他jQuery功能的场景,直接使用原生JavaScript可能更高效:

document.getElementById('element').id;

这种方法避免了jQuery的开销,执行速度更快。

标签: 元素jquery
分享给朋友:

相关文章

jquery插件

jquery插件

jQuery 插件开发指南 jQuery 插件是一种扩展 jQuery 功能的模块化方式,允许开发者封装可重用的代码。以下是开发和使用 jQuery 插件的基本方法。 插件基本结构 jQuery 插…

jquery添加

jquery添加

jQuery 添加元素的方法 在jQuery中,添加元素到DOM有多种方式,可以根据需求选择合适的方法。 append() 将内容插入到选定元素的内部末尾处。 $("#container").ap…

jquery 切换

jquery 切换

jQuery 切换操作 jQuery 提供了多种切换元素状态的方法,包括显示/隐藏、类切换、属性切换等。以下是常见的切换操作实现方式。 显示与隐藏切换 使用 toggle() 方法可以在显示和隐藏之…

jquery视频

jquery视频

以下是关于 jQuery 视频学习资源的整理,涵盖免费教程、实战项目和进阶内容: 免费在线教程 W3School jQuery 教程 提供基础语法、选择器、事件处理等内容的交互式练习,适合快速入门。…

jquery 查询

jquery 查询

jQuery 查询方法 jQuery 提供了多种方法来查询和操作 DOM 元素,以下是一些常用的查询方法: 基本选择器 使用 $() 或 jQuery() 函数可以通过 CSS 选择器查找元素:…

jquery 拖动

jquery 拖动

jQuery 拖动实现方法 jQuery本身不直接提供拖动功能,但可以通过结合jQuery UI或原生HTML5的拖放API实现。以下是两种常见方法: 使用jQuery UI实现拖动 jQuery…